What youll do

The Senior Program and Strategy manager will be responsible for orchestrating and executing strategic deployment initiatives. This high-level role requires expertise in managing complex programs cross-functional coordination and deploying regional go-to-market strategies.

Marketing PMO and Strategic Planning:

  • Develop and operationalize governance models for multi-site deployment initiatives
  • Coordinate deployment phases and ensure compliance with critical milestones
  • Facilitate governance committees and performance reviews with executive stakeholders
  • Maintain program documentation (methodologies templates processes)

Program Management and Deployment:

  • Manage implementation and deployment of programs/projects
  • Ensure alignment of construction triage and process development
  • Coordinate unified Go-to-Market planning (annual/quarterly)

Strategic Planning and Execution:

  • Develop and maintain deployment models for complex regional initiatives
  • Orchestrate integrated go-to-market strategies combining macro and micro approaches
  • Define and optimize corporate and local marketing strategies
  • Coordinate with infrastructure teams for deployment schedule alignment

Stakeholder Management:

  • Serve as primary point of contact between executive leadership and regional deployment teams
  • Coordinate with regional leaders for strategic initiative execution
  • Manage relationships with external partners and service providers
  • Present strategic updates to executive leadership and governance committees

Performance and Analytics:

  • Define and track performance indicators by deployment phase
  • Implement critical milestone tracking systems
  • Analyze regional performance data and provide actionable insights
  • Create dashboards for near real-time initiative tracking

Qualifications

What you bring

Education and Experience:


Bachelors degree in business administration strategy project management or related field (MBA a major asset)
Minimum 10-12 years of experience managing complex strategic programs
At least 5 years in strategic leadership role or management consulting
Demonstrated experience in multi-site or multi-geography program deployment
Knowledge of telecommunications sector or technology infrastructure (an asset)

Technical Skills:

  • Expertise in project and program management methodologies (Agile Waterfall Hybrid)
  • Proficiency in program and portfolio management tools
  • Advanced skills in data analysis and analytical dashboard creation
  • Knowledge of go-to-market strategies and multi-channel marketing

Interpersonal Skills:

  • Exceptional leadership and ability to influence without direct hierarchical authority
  • Excellent communication skills (written and oral) in French and English (bilingual essential)
  • Strategic and analytical thinking with strong execution orientation
  • Ability to manage ambiguity and make decisions in a complex environment
